Manhattan District Attorney Alvin Bragg has been “struggling” to get a grand jury to indict former President Donald Trump, two sources familiar with the Manhattan DA office told the Daily Mail.
One source called Bragg’s case “weak” and said it is causing a rift within the DA’s office. “They are having trouble convincing the jury to swallow the case. It’s a weak case and has caused divisions in the DA’s office.”This revelation comes after the grand jury ended up not meeting on Wednesday to consider the charges against the former president.
